Lake Joondalup Baptist College seeks to appoint a Primary Education Assistant. The successful applicant will be required to fully support teachers in the implementation of learning programs for primary students within an inclusive environment.
This position is 0.8 FTE (Monday, Tuesday, Thursday, Friday) for a fixed term contract 20/07/2026 - 11/09/2026.
Duties
Lead small group work in Literacy, Mathematics and other learning areas to provide the agreed educational outcome by the class teacher.
Listen to one-on-one reading by students and participate in Learning Enhancement reading programs.
Gather diagnostic information on students with learning support needs, record student observations and liaise with teachers of the students being supported to monitor student progress and coursework completion.
Become familiar with Individual Learning Plans (ILPs) and Curriculum Adjustment Plans (CAPs) and support their implementation within the class.
Assist with general administration.
Qualifications / Requirements
Certificate IV in Education Support/Special Needs
Knowledge and experience of how to work with students with Autism Spectrum Disorder.
Working with Children Check (mandatory) or proof of application prior to commencement.
Nationally Coordinated Criminal History Check through Department of Education Western Australia less than six months old (mandatory) or proof of application prior to commencement.
Demonstrated high level of organisational ability and initiative including experience in work planning and prioritising to meet deadlines.
Ability to maintain confidentiality about all matters at all times.
A practicing Christian, and a written reference from your pastor/minister is desirable.
